First Aid Measures
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ents
To immediately move away the person from the polluted atmosphere and to call a doctor.
Symptoms: Irritating for the respiratory tracts. Inhalation of vapors in high concentrations have a narcotic effect on the central nervous system.
Remove soaked clothing and cleanse skin with soap and water.
Symptoms: A prolonged or repeated contact may dry skin and cause irritation.
Wash with plenty of clean, fresh water for several minutes.
Do not ingest. Do not induce vomiting to avoid the risk of aspiration into the airways. Do not drink, do not induce vomiting.
Symptoms: In the event of accidental ingestion, the product can be aspired in the lungs because of its low viscosity and cause serious pulmonary lesions in the hours which follow.
Immediate Medical Attention
If irritation persists, consult a Ophthalmology. If irritation appears or if the contamination is extensive and prolonged, consult a doctor. Immediately transfer the person to a doctor, by showing the product label.
Medical Treatment
Treat symptomatically.

Exposure Controls / PPE
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ment
Use suitable protective gloves that are resistant to chemical agents in accordance with standard EN374. Type of gloves recommended : PVA (Polyvinyl alcohol), Nitrile rubber (butadiene-acrylonitrile copolymer rubber (NBR)), Viton® (Hexafluoropropylene copolymer and vinylidene fluoride). Thickness of the gloves Nitrile > 0.55mm. Penetration time> 480 min. In case of contact through splashing: -Rubber nitrile: thickness of>0.38 mm and penetration time> 60 minutes; -Neoprene: thickness of>0.75 mm and penetration time> 60 minutes
Before handling, it is necessary to wear protective glasses Side accordance with standard EN166.
When workers are confronted with concentrations that are above occupational exposure limits, they must wear a suitable, approved, respiratory protection device. Type of mask with combined filters : Wear a mask in accordance with standard EN136. Wear a half mask in accordance with standard EN140. Anti-gas and vapour filter(s) (Combined filters) in accordance with standard EN14387 : -A. Particle filter according to standard EN143 : - P2 (White)
Wear suitable protective clothing.

What are the hazard statements for White spirit?
This substance has 5 hazard statements:
- H226: Flammable liquid and vapour.
- H304: May be fatal if swallowed and enters airways.
- H336: May cause drowsiness or dizziness.
- H372: Causes damage to organs through prolonged or repeated exposure (central nervous system) (if inhaled).
- H411: To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ects.
